In 2024, Schweinfurt presents a low crime environment, with residents expressing confidence in the safety of their city. While the perception of crime is minimal, certain issues still require attention to maintain public security.
Overall, feelings of safety are prominent, particularly during daylight hours, reflecting a well-maintained peace in the community.
Schweinfurt has achieved commendable progress in air quality, offering a pleasant environment for its residents. Although industrial and vehicular emissions influence pollution levels, the overall air quality is positive.
Public perception regarding air quality is largely favorable, with environmental air considered to be clean and conducive to a healthy lifestyle.
Noise pollution is a concern in Schweinfurt, primarily due to urban activity and local industry, contributing to some dissatisfaction among residents.
While garbage disposal is generally adequate, there are still areas for improvement, as some residents express mild dissatisfaction with waste management practices.
Schweinfurt’s green spaces are highly appreciated, providing essential recreational areas and enhancing community well-being. These parks are seen as a crucial part of the urban landscape.
Despite some concerns, the city maintains a reputation for effective water quality management, ensuring that residents have access to safe and clean drinking water.
